2.0 out of 5 stars Bipolar Balancing Act, November 6, 2010
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Bipolar Balancing Act: Journeying through the valleys and peaks of manic-depression (through the eyes of two who have been there) (Paperback)
The bipolar illness is not easily described nor shared with others. Bipolar Balancing Act boldly shares personal experiences and learnings and for this reason should be commended. It also explains one of the most powerful aspects of the illness - the way it affects a person's development, life experience (both in the short and long term) when the illness is acute and when it has been in remission for a long time. The book uses rules frequently, and this is less helpful. Personal rules tend to create a feeling of security, but they simplify the complexities of the illness and are best used for the individual rather than promoted as a solution for all sufferers. What is most lacking in this book is a complete and coherent story to bring the life experiences of Rich and Carol Melcher together, so that the reader can share the journey. The book tries too much to describe the problem rather than share the story. Rich and Carol are brave to have made this contribution - the bipolar condition is always worsened by a lack of people who share understanding of the illness - but hopefully a second book might focus on story rather than remedy.
